SPECT/CT 在足部和踝关节病变成像中的应用——其他配准技术的终结。

SPECT/CT in imaging foot and ankle pathology-the demise of other coregistration techniques.

机构信息

Department of Nuclear Medicine, Guy's and St. Thomas' Hospitals, NHS Trust, London, United Kingdom.

出版信息

Semin Nucl Med. 2010 Jan;40(1):41-51. doi: 10.1053/j.semnuclmed.2009.08.004.

DOI:10.1053/j.semnuclmed.2009.08.004
PMID:19958849
Abstract

Disorders of the ankle and foot are common and given the complex anatomy and function of the foot, they present a significant clinical challenge. Imaging plays a crucial role in the management of these patients, with multiple imaging options available to the clinician. The American College of radiology has set the appropriateness criteria for the use of the available investigating modalities in the management of foot and ankle pathologies. These are broadly classified into anatomical and functional imaging modalities. Recently, single-photon emission computed tomography and/or computed tomography scanners, which can elegantly combine functional and anatomical images have been introduced, promising an exciting and important development. This review describes our clinical experience with single-photon emission computed tomography and/or computed tomography and discusses potential applications of these techniques.

摘要

踝关节和足部疾病很常见,由于足部解剖结构和功能复杂,因此给临床带来了重大挑战。影像学在这些患者的管理中起着至关重要的作用,临床医生有多种影像学选择。美国放射学会为管理足踝病变中可用的检查方式的使用制定了适宜性标准。这些广泛分为解剖和功能影像学方式。最近,单光子发射计算机断层扫描和/或计算机断层扫描仪的引入,能够优雅地结合功能和解剖图像,有望带来令人兴奋和重要的发展。本文回顾了我们在单光子发射计算机断层扫描和/或计算机断层扫描方面的临床经验,并讨论了这些技术的潜在应用。
